I just applied to the UCLA EMBA program (last week). I hope I get in.

My profile:
work experience: 12 years (10 in management). pretty solid work experience including my own company, etc.
GMAT: 730 (96th percentile)
undergrad GPA: 2.6 at UC Berkeley

I sat in on a class and visited the campus for an info session.
